Day36 - Quiz를 풀어 봅시다

2021. 4. 6. 22:02Oracle 공부/Quiz

문제 1. 
employees테이블, departments테이블을 left조인 hire_date를 오름차순 기준으로 1-10번째 데이터만 출력합니다
조건) rownum을 적용하여 번호, 직원아이디, 이름, 전화번호, 입사일, 부서아이디, 부서이름 을 출력합니다.
조건) hire_date를 기준으로 오름차순 정렬 되어야 합니다. rownum이 틀어지면 안됩니다.

- 쌤 답.

문제 2. 
-EMPLOYEES 과 DEPARTMENTS 테이블에서 JOB_ID가 SA_MAN 사원의 정보의 LAST_NAME, JOB_ID, DEPARTMENT_ID,DEPARTMENT_NAME을 출력하세요

- 쌤 답

문제 3.
-DEPARTMENT테이블에서 각 부서의 ID, NAME, MANAGER_ID와 부서에 속한 인원수를 출력하세요.
-인원수 기준 내림차순 정렬하세요.
-사람이 없는 부서는 출력하지 뽑지 않습니다

- 쌤 답2 ( 1은 내가 풀은 것과 비슷 )

문제 4.
-부서에 대한 정보 전부와, 주소, 우편번호, 부서별 평균 연봉을 구해서 출력하세요
-부서별 평균이 없으면 0으로 출력하세요

- 쌤 답1

- 쌤 답2

문제 5.
-문제 15결과에 대해 DEPARTMENT_ID기준으로 내림차순 정렬해서 ROWNUM을 붙여 1-10데이터 까지만 출력하세요

- 쌤 답

 

'Oracle 공부 > Quiz' 카테고리의 다른 글

Day38 - Quiz를 풀어 봅시다  (0) 2021.04.08
Day37 - Quiz를 풀어 봅시다  (0) 2021.04.07
Day35 - Quiz를 풀어 봅시다  (0) 2021.04.05
Day34 - Quiz를 풀어 봅시다  (0) 2021.04.02
Day33 - Quiz를 풀어 봅시다.  (0) 2021.04.01